Hair Sheep

In early 2024 we expanded by bringing in small herd of specialty hair sheep -- ASDS registered Dorper sheep and commercial Katahdin x Dorper sheep.

Dorper and Katahdin are both hair sheep, which means they do not require sharing. However, they produce high quality meat while also being docile and easy to handle, weather hardy, feed efficient, and parasite resistant. 

 

In late summer we added the key to it all -- an amazing Dorper ram we call Bart. Bart is a grandson of RR Dorpers Patriot and we are so pleased to see his offspring!
